Warning Signs You Need Multi-Family Water Damage Restoration

Ignoring the sign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s and even health hazards. Look out for these warning signs and don’t hesitate to call our team: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ors can be a sign of hidden water damage.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it’s time to investigate further.

Water Stains on Ceilings and Walls

Discoloration on ceilings and walls can show water damage. If you notice any unusual stains or discoloration, it’s essential to address the issue quickly.

Warped or Buckled Floors

Warped or buckled floors can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ance or feel of your floors, it’s time to call our team.

Discoloration on Paint or Wallpaper

Discoloration on paint or wallpaper can show water damage. If you notice any unusual changes in the appearance of your walls, it’s time to investigate further.

Peeling or Cracking Paint

Peeling or cracking paint can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any unusual changes in the appearance of your walls, it’s time to call our team.

Multi-Family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Pro

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water leak under sink Yes No DIY-friendly and easy to fix
Standing water in multiple rooms No Yes Large-scale water damage needs professional equipment and expertise
Water damage from burst pipe No Yes Quick response time and proper equipment are crucial to prevent further damage
Musty odors and discoloration No Yes Hidden water damage can lead to health hazards and costly repairs
Warped or buckled floors No Yes Professionals have the necessary equipment and expertise to repair and restore floors

Multi-Family Water Damage Restoration Cost in Fort Hunt, VA

The cost of multi-family water damage restoration in Fort Hunt, VA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Cleaning and sanitizing $1,000 – $5,000 Extent of cleaning and sanitizing required, type of cleaning solutions used
Reconstruction and repair $2,000 – $10,000 Scope of repairs, materials needed
Final inspection and quality control $500 – $2,000 Complexity of inspection, number of revisions needed
